Short bio

Dr. Otilia Clipa is a distinguished professor in the Department of Educational Sciences at Ștefan cel Mare University of Suceava, Romania. With a PhD in Education Sciences from Alexandru Ioan Cuza University, her academic journey has been dedicated to improving early childhood education and teacher training. Her extensive research and publications have significantly contributed to the field of educational policies and curriculum development. Dr. Clipa’s commitment to education extends beyond her university duties as she actively participates in various educational reform projects aimed at enhancing the quality of education in Romania.

Educational Details

  • PhD in Education Sciences
    • Institution: Alexandru Ioan Cuza University, Iași, Romania
    • Year of Completion: 2008
  • Master’s Degree in Educational Management
    • Institution: Ștefan cel Mare University of Suceava, Suceava, Romania
    • Year of Completion: 2003
  • Bachelor’s Degree in Primary and Preschool Education
    • Institution: Ștefan cel Mare University of Suceava, Suceava, Romania
    • Year of Completion: 1998

Professional Experience

  • Professor
    • Institution: Ștefan cel Mare University of Suceava, Romania
    • Years: 2012 – Present
    • Department: Educational Sciences
  • Researcher
    • Institution: Ștefan cel Mare University of Suceava, Romania
    • Years: 2009 – 2012
    • Focus Areas: Early Childhood Education, Teacher Training, Educational Policies
  • Lecturer
    • Institution: Ștefan cel Mare University of Suceava, Romania
    • Years: 2003 – 2009
    • Courses: Educational Management, Pedagogy, Curriculum Development

Research Interest:

  • Early Childhood Education: Exploring best practices, methodologies, and policies to enhance learning experiences and outcomes for young children.
  • Teacher Training and Professional Development: Investigating effective strategies for teacher education, ongoing professional development, and the impact of teacher training on educational quality.
  • Educational Policies and Reforms: Analyzing the implementation and effects of educational policies, with a focus on reform initiatives aimed at improving educational systems and student performance.
  • Curriculum Development: Designing, evaluating, and improving curricula to meet the diverse needs of learners and align with educational standards and goals.
  • Educational Management: Studying the principles and practices of educational leadership, administration, and organizational management in educational settings.
